What the Field column means

Two columns Elo alone cannot give you. Field is the average rating of the opponents a player actually faced, with how many entrants their events had on average: the same score can be built grinding eight-player events against unrated opposition, or playing 200-player regionals. When the field stays around 1500 or events run under 16 entrants, the number is flagged. vs top 5% answers the same question match by match: how many they won against the 2,503 players rated above 1700. The gap is stark — some sit at 59%, others with a higher Elo sit at 30%. Computing these takes the full entry list of every event plus a rating system: sites that start from decklists cannot.
